Explanation:
The two lines cross at this location. This (x,y) point is located on both lines at the same time. A point on a line satisfies that said equation.
----------
An algebraic way to confirm the answer is to apply substitution to the first equation like so:
y = x+4
6 = 2+4
6 = 6
Repeat for the second equation
y = -0.5x+7
6 = -0.5*2+7
6 = -1+7
6 = 6
We end up with true equations for both cases, so this algebraically confirms (2,6) is the solution to the given system.
